PSASA is the professional association for speakers. We consider “speaker” to include trainers, facilitators, coaches, consultants, adult educators, and keynoters. It is the place to meet with and learn from some of the best.

PSASA is a professional association for people involved in the speaking business. Our members are versatile and diverse. They represent all aspects of the speaking business. All make their living, or part of their living, speaking to and/or working with groups as trainers, facilitators, coaches, consultants, adult educators, and keynoters.

PSASA is committed to building a better future for the professional speaking business in South Africa. We help our members succeed in their speaking businesses through learning partnerships, market development and professional accreditation. We also support international advancement of the speaking profession through our participation in and support for the International Federation for Professional Speakers.

 

So what are some of the benefits of membership in PSASA?

 

  • Membership in a local Chapter at no extra cost (as chapters are formed)
  • Increased profile through the PSASA website
  • Membership in the International Federation For Professional Speakers (IFFPS) at no extra cost – which in itself offers a host of benefits, like eligibility to attend conventions hosted by affiliated Speakers Associations around the globe
  • The opportunity to meet the requirements for your Certified Speaking Professional designation (CSP) - you must be a member of PSASA in order to make application
  • Professional and business development at meetings, networking groups and the conventions
  • Networking with experts who speak professionally
  • A Community of Support - not just "how to's" but also fellowship and fun with those who understand the business
  • Mentorship programs for developing speakers
  • Educational Publications
  • Help with developing the eight professional competencies for professional speaking.
  • Professional membership of an organisation with a clear code of professional ethics.

The monthly Professional Speaker magazine from the National Speakers Association (NSA, USA), features the latest tips and trends on:

  • speaking
  • training and facilitating
  • professional relationships
  • keynoting
  • marketing
  • sales
  • technology
  • business management
  • topic development
  • humour
  • platform skills
  • developing products

In addition, Voices of Experience, a monthly audiocassette, features interviews with the masters of the speaking business worldwide. These publications are mailed 10 times per year and are received by all members (4 times a year until we have 150 members).

These are some of the many benefits of membership.
